Background / History
During the Chaos Era, Pangu was the foremost Chaos Demon God, capable of overpowering the other Chaos Demon Gods alone and standing only a step from the Great Dao Realm. Despite initially caring only for his own survival, he was bound by the Great Dao’s karma and the unavoidable Great Trend to carry out World Creation. 57 138 146
Foreseeing the Gate of Taboo as a threat he could not defeat directly, Pangu prepared a contingency during the opening of the heavens. He split himself, deliberately intensified the Chaos Great Tribulation to create an opening for the Gate of Taboo, and allowed a counterpart—later called the Foreign Pangu—to emerge. Pangu then suppressed and exchanged places with that counterpart, severing their connection and concealing their shared identity. 147
After World Creation destroyed his physical body, a wisp of Pangu’s True Spirit entered the Primordial Era and assumed the identity of Zhen Yuanzi. From Wanshou Mountain’s Wuzhuang Temple, he acted as Shi Chen’s subordinate while covertly observing the Gate of Taboo and advancing his own plans. 63 104
Tang Xuan eventually exposed Zhen Yuanzi as Pangu. Pangu then ceased concealing his identity from Tang Xuan’s allies, though he continued using deception against Shi Chen, the Gate of Taboo, and other hostile forces. 61 104

Personality
Pangu was notoriously arrogant during the Chaos Era, treating the other Chaos Demon Gods as beneath him and leaving many of them with lasting hostility. 61
Behind that arrogance, he is highly patient, suspicious, and calculating. He refuses to underestimate the Gate of Taboo, assumes its apparent weaknesses may conceal deeper contingencies, and willingly spends vast periods preparing layered schemes. 130 147
His primary motivation is survival and resistance to control rather than simple altruism. Although he acknowledges that he and other Primordial beings are pieces in Senior River God’s greater plan, he accepts that role if it gives him a viable path to strike back against the Gate of Taboo. 146 154

Martial Dao System
Pangu developed the Blood Essence Martial Path, a body-centered cultivation system that treats physical strength as its foundation and uses Qi and Divine Power to command that body. 131 135
- The Blood Essence Martial Path emphasizes essence as its core and Qi as its support. 135
- Pangu merged his system with the Foreign Pangu’s Human Immortal Martial Dao. 131 135
- Their completed Martial Dao System became the highest-ranked High-tier System in the Primordial Era. 145 146
- Its elevated status enabled Pangu to begin breaking the seals obstructing memories related to the Gate of Taboo. 146
